#tweeterhovershow,
#bookfacehovershow,
#vimeohovershow,
#spacers,
#linkededinhovershow  {
   z-index: 20;
}

#tweeterbutton,
#vimeobutton,
#bookfacebutton,
#linkededinbutton  {
   z-index: 19;
}

#i1717topofpagebuttontext  {
   margin-bottom: 12px;
   margin-top: -3px;
   margin-right: 0px;
   margin-left: 502px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 139px;
   height: 19px;
   text-align: left;
   font-family: Georgia-Italic, Georgia, serif;
   font-size: 14px;
   line-height: 19px;
}

#i1715topofpagebuttontext  {
   margin-bottom: 13px;
   margin-top: -9px;
   margin-right: 0px;
   margin-left: 502px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 141px;
   height: 23px;
   text-align: left;
   font-family: Georgia-Italic, Georgia, serif;
   font-size: 14px;
   line-height: 23px;
}

#i1716topofpagebuttontext  {
   margin-bottom: 10px;
   margin-top: 1px;
   margin-right: 0px;
   margin-left: 502px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 141px;
   height: 16px;
   text-align: left;
   font-family: Georgia-Italic, Georgia, serif;
   font-size: 14px;
   line-height: 16px;
}

#i1718topofpagebuttontext  {
   margin-bottom: 11px;
   margin-top: 52px;
   margin-right: 0px;
   margin-left: 296px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 143px;
   height: 16px;
   text-align: left;
   font-family: Georgia-Italic, Georgia, serif;
   font-size: 14px;
   line-height: 16px;
}

#socialsidebarpanelfixed  {
   z-index: 18;
}

#i1072sidebarcolumnfixed  {
   z-index: 15;
}

#portfoliodottedline  {
   margin-bottom: 0px;
   margin-right: 0px;
   left: 0px;
   margin-top: 5px;
   margin-left: 6px;
   top: 0px;
   position: relative;
}

#footerpanelfollow  {
   margin-top: 77px;
}

#i2065emailbutton  {
   margin-bottom: 0px;
}

#disclaimertext  {
   margin-top: 0px;
   margin-left: 0px;
   width: 638px;
   z-index: 3;
   top: 2652px;
   left: 310px;
   position: absolute;
}

#i1074navlines  {
   z-index: 16;
}

#topofpagetext  {
   margin-bottom: 5px;
   margin-top: 9px;
   margin-right: 0px;
   margin-left: 30px;
   position: relative;
   left: 0px;
   top: 0px;
   width: 201px;
}

#page_content  {
   min-height: 3676px;
}

#layer1  {
   background-repeat: no-repeat;
   background-image: url(sg_portfolio_media/layer1.gif);
   margin-top: 0px;
   margin-left: 0px;
   height: 123px;
   width: 202px;
   z-index: 13;
   top: 2px;
   left: 4px;
   position: absolute;
}

.c15414D * a  {
   color: #15414D;
}

